5 Techniques To Decrease Your Costs With Cheaper Auto Insurance Estimates

With gas costs constantly on the rise, car insurance is one area in which we can save some cash. Many of us pay more than we need to just because we don’t take time to seek out the best deals. If you want to find cheap auto insurance quotes, then here our top five tips.

How Often You Drive and The Type of Car You Drive – It’s typically more expensive to insure newer vehicles that make use of costly technology. Some anti-theft or safety features like alarms, air bags, and so on may help ameliorate the generally higher costs of insuring new automobiles.

On the flip side, the less you use the car, the less chance you have of getting in an accident and the less your policy will generally cost. Of course this varies depending on why you use the vehicle, and other factors, but be sure to tell your insurance company if you use your car less – it’ll pay off!

The Coverage Type – It goes without saying that, in general, the more comprehensive your insurance, the more you’ll need to pay. Be sure to get the kind of insurance you need, but if you really want to save money and get cheap auto insurance quotes then avoiding add-ons can help. You could also opt to pay a higher deductible, but it’s important to find the balance between the savings and being able to actually afford the deductible when it comes down to it.

Opt for Gender Specific Insurance Companies – Men can’t take advantage of this, but statistics say that women make fewer claims, meaning car insurance is often cheaper if you go for a female-only deal. More and more insurance companies are also now targeted exclusively at women.

Show That You’re A Good Driver – If you can prove that you’re a good driver then you’re going to be seen as less of a risk in the eyes of the insurer. This puts new drivers at a disadvantage, but you can always take an advanced driving course to reduce your premium. If you’ve been driving for longer, building up a no claims period can greatly reduce the amount you pay.

Do Your Research and Compare – Every insurer is different, and one that offers the best deal for women, for example, might not be the same as one that offers the best deals for newer drivers. Find a comparison website that covers your state and you can make the task of researching and comparing far quicker than it would have been otherwise.

Getting cheap auto insurance quotes is never guaranteed – there are simply too many factors at play. But, if you do your research and compare as many policies as possible, you’re sure to make significant savings.

Question by AF Wife Mrs. Greene: With usaa auto insurance claims if the estimate is over 3000 dollars I recieve a 2 party check..Can i cash it?
I have hail damage and my estimate is over 4100 dollars. They said i will recieve a two-party check! Will my name be on it and my bank? Can i cash the check myself or does it go to my lender, because i choose direct deposit of the check

Best answer:

Answer by someone
NO you cannot. You endorse it and mail it to your lender. They will sent you the money AFTER you have the car repaired or send it directly to the repair shop.

    As long as you have a loan on your car, the lender will be listed on the check. The way around that, is to ask them to pay the body shop directly.

    You cannot cash it, until you’ve paid off the loan. The whole POINT of having the lender listed on the check, is so that you can’t take the money, and leave the car with damage, while the lender still owns part of it.
